In the modern world, the study of measurement is an essential component in many fields, including manufacturing, engineering, science and technology.


Within these fields, metrology is used to validate and verify pre-defined standards.

Metrology is important because almost all of everyday life, not to mention practical science, technology, engineering and medicine,


involves measurements that we rely on for our health, commercial prosperity, quality of life and the protection of the environment.



Metrology is the science of high accuracy measurement. It is the technology behind the assurance of quality in the manufacturing process.



Metrology enables automotive manufacturers to produce numerous identical parts of sophisticated equipment, and it helps make sure that your car runs smoothly and safely.



Metrology is relevant to part production in two primary ways. Before manufacturing starts, metrological instruments are used to calibrate the machinery and tooling that will be used during production, which helps to ensure accurate and precise parts.


Quite simply, Metrology is the scientific study of measurement. Concerning advanced manufacturing, Metrology is acknowledged to be the methodology and science behind quality control.
